Avatar billede inkognito1 Nybegynder
20. august 2002 - 01:50 Der er 2 kommentarer og
1 løsning

Default Value ligesom getdate()

Hej,

Jeg bruger getdate() som skriver dato + tidspunkt.

Jeg ville høre om der findes en value hvor der skrives datoen.

Findes der evt. en oversigt over hvilke default Values der kan brgues direkte i databasen.

Håber en kan hjælpe :o)
Avatar billede bennytordrup Nybegynder
20. august 2002 - 07:03 #1
create table Dummy
(
  Dum nvarchar(10),
  Dato datetime default cast(convert(nvarchar(10), GetDate(), 112) as datetime)
)
Avatar billede inkognito1 Nybegynder
20. august 2002 - 15:35 #2
Hvor skal jeg indsætte dette ?? jeg bruger getdate i default value direkte i database.
Avatar billede bennytordrup Nybegynder
20. august 2002 - 16:33 #3
Øh, nu er jeg ikke med i din tankegang.

Det, jeg skrev, opretter en tabel, hvor feltet Dato altid indeholder datoen ud fra hvad GetDate() returnerer. Tidspunktet bliver strippet.

Hvis du blot skal bruge selve manipulationen af GetDate(), så er det

cast(convert(nvarchar(10), GetDate(), 112) as datetime)

du skal bruge i stedet for GetDate().
Avatar billede Ny bruger Nybegynder

Din løsning...

Tilladte BB-code-tags: [b]fed[/b] [i]kursiv[/i] [u]understreget[/u] Web- og emailadresser omdannes automatisk til links. Der sættes "nofollow" på alle links.

Loading billede Opret Preview
Kategori
Computerworld tilbyder specialiserede kurser i database-management

Log ind eller opret profil

Hov!

For at kunne deltage på Computerworld Eksperten skal du være logget ind.

Det er heldigvis nemt at oprette en bruger: Det tager to minutter og du kan vælge at bruge enten e-mail, Facebook eller Google som login.

Du kan også logge ind via nedenstående tjenester